All six simulated building profiles were re-run against the previous engine's output, and dispatch latency deltas stayed within tolerance. We retired the legacy queue model and archived its state snapshots. One caveat: the morning-peak scenario now completes faster, so downstream report timings shifted slightly — nothing broken, just earlier. For your records, the production engine is now running with these configuration values.

config for kafof-bawef:
holath:
  log_level: debug
  metrics_host: metrics.holath.qorvelsys.internal
  pin: 2191
  pool_size: 32

Subject: Customer-Support Outsourcing Plan

Team,

Branch managers should note that Ostrevane Group will transition tier-one support for the Lumetta product line to an external partner, Carridale Services, starting next quarter. In-house staff will move to tier-two and retention work; no redundancies are planned this phase. Branch call routing changes take effect at cutover. Training materials follow next week. The broader plan driving this change is summarised below.

board note of bawep-tajef: Queniusek Systems plans to raise the Quenvan list price by 53.1 percent in March. The pricing group signed off on a budget of $176.4 million for Project Drueth. The renewal with Casionix Partners closes at $142.5 million a year, 8.3 percent below the last contract. Project Fraax slips by six weeks because of the tooling delay.

## Ownership

The Burrowmap dependency graph visualizer is maintained by the Platform Insight team at Veldtware. The parser, renderer, and export pipeline each have a designated reviewer; security-relevant changes (archive ingestion, SVG export, remote manifest fetching) require an additional sign-off. Vulnerability reports should be filed under the private tracker component rather than the public board. The accountable owner for security escalations is named below.

signatory, hawep-fahof: Ralwyn Casdor